Source: Tourism MediaWaikiki BeachThe WorldNorth AmericaUSAPacific CountyWashington StateLong BeachIlwacoWaikiki Beach
Source: Tourism MediaWaikiki BeachThe WorldNorth AmericaUSAPacific CountyWashington StateLong BeachIlwacoWaikiki Beach
Source: Tourism MediaWaikiki BeachThe WorldNorth AmericaUSAPacific CountyWashington StateLong BeachIlwacoWaikiki Beach
Source: Tourism MediaWaikiki BeachThe WorldNorth AmericaUSAPacific CountyWashington StateLong BeachIlwacoWaikiki Beach
Source: Tourism MediaWaikiki BeachThe WorldNorth AmericaUSAPacific CountyWashington StateLong BeachIlwacoWaikiki Beach
Source: Tourism MediaWaikiki BeachThe WorldNorth AmericaUSAPacific CountyWashington StateLong BeachIlwacoWaikiki Beach
Source: Tourism MediaWaikiki BeachThe WorldNorth AmericaUSAPacific CountyWashington StateLong BeachIlwacoWaikiki Beach
Source: Tourism MediaWaikiki BeachThe WorldNorth AmericaUSAPacific CountyWashington StateLong BeachIlwacoWaikiki Beach
Source: Tourism MediaWaikiki BeachThe WorldNorth AmericaUSAPacific CountyWashington StateLong BeachIlwacoWaikiki Beach
Source: Tourism MediaWaikiki BeachThe WorldNorth AmericaUSAPacific CountyWashington StateLong BeachIlwacoWaikiki Beach
Source: Tourism MediaWaikiki BeachThe WorldNorth AmericaUSAPacific CountyWashington StateLong BeachIlwacoWaikiki Beach
Source: Tourism MediaWaikiki BeachThe WorldNorth AmericaUSAPacific CountyWashington StateLong BeachIlwacoWaikiki Beach